Transforming Tax Prep with Codex: Self-Improving Agents in Action
OpenAI teams up with Thrive Holdings for smarter tax solutions.
OpenAI’s recent collaboration with Thrive Holdings has led to the development of a self-improving tax agent system called Tax AI, which has achieved impressive metrics: it automates tax preparation and now saves practitioners a third of their time while drafting returns with up to 97% accuracy. This innovation leverages a structured feedback loop that continuously enhances the AI's capabilities based on real-world usage.

Cognition's Bold Move: $1B Funding and AI Coding on the Rise
With backing from top investors, Cognition's Devin is changing the software game.
AI coding startup Cognition has raised over $1 billion, boosting its pre-money valuation to $25 billion. This funding, led by Lux Capital and General Catalyst, reflects strong demand as Cognition’s autonomous software engineer, Devin, grows in popularity with enterprise giants like NASA and Goldman Sachs.

Critical Flaw Found in Starlette Framework: Millions at Risk
A serious vulnerability could expose sensitive data across many AI applications.
A newly discovered vulnerability in the Starlette framework, tracked as CVE-2026-48710, threatens millions of AI agents by allowing unauthorized access to sensitive data. This flaw can affect various applications relying on Starlette and was deemed trivial to exploit, raising alarms among security researchers.
💡 Why it matters
If you're using applications that leverage Starlette, particularly in production, this vulnerability could put your data at risk. The good news? There's a scanner available to check if your systems are affected, allowing for urgent corrective action.
👀 What to notice
- Millions of servers globally use Starlette—make sure yours isn't vulnerable.
- Run vulnerability scans today to assess your applications.
- Review documentation for any frameworks that rely on Starlette, like FastAPI.
- Update to Starlette version 1.0.1 or higher to patch the vulnerability.

OpenRouter's Valuation Skyrockets to $1.3B
A major funding round signals a shift in AI model usage.
OpenRouter, a platform connecting users to multiple AI models, has secured $113 million in a Series B round, boosting its valuation from $547 million to $1.3 billion in just a year. This growth reflects a shift in AI development focus from training models to using them effectively in real-world applications.
